    About Bertilla

    A name like Bertilla offers a charming journey back in time, perfect for parents who appreciate a sense of history and understated elegance. With its Old Germanic roots meaning "bright, famous," Bertilla carries a quiet strength, evoking images of medieval European courts without feeling overly ornate. It’s a distinctive choice for those seeking a vintage name that stands out, yet remains gracefully familiar, unlike many other Germanic names that have either faded into obscurity or become commonplace. This name suits a child destined for a life of quiet brilliance and a unique personal style, rather than one who needs to constantly grab attention.
